Output ed6d432b217e77bc9e513b2cae6dfdab197efd8f4ecfdee91cfdfda1f59afb68:1

value
4016672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ef75cc6bd51a38c79b65171b0bccf267187be3c7 OP_EQUAL
address
3PXAYBA1nVaqTDWNrNFretud9VuUXua7ge
transaction
ed6d432b217e77bc9e513b2cae6dfdab197efd8f4ecfdee91cfdfda1f59afb68
confirmations
270358
spent
true